Home
last modified time | relevance | path

Searched refs:SortableAddress (Results 1 – 2 of 2) sorted by relevance

/packages/modules/Connectivity/framework/src/android/net/util/
DDnsUtils.java56 private static final Comparator<SortableAddress> sRfc6724Comparator = new Rfc6724Comparator();
61 public static class Rfc6724Comparator implements Comparator<SortableAddress> {
64 public int compare(SortableAddress span1, SortableAddress span2) { in compare()
108 public static class SortableAddress { class in DnsUtils
118 public SortableAddress(@NonNull InetAddress addr, @Nullable InetAddress srcAddr) { in SortableAddress() method in DnsUtils.SortableAddress
142 final ArrayList<SortableAddress> sortableAnswerList = new ArrayList<>(); in rfc6724Sort()
144 sortableAnswerList.add(new SortableAddress(addr, findSrcAddress(network, addr))); in rfc6724Sort()
150 for (SortableAddress ans : sortableAnswerList) { in rfc6724Sort()
/packages/modules/Connectivity/tests/unit/java/android/net/util/
DDnsUtilsTest.java51 private DnsUtils.SortableAddress makeSortableAddress(@NonNull String addr) { in makeSortableAddress()
55 private DnsUtils.SortableAddress makeSortableAddress(@NonNull String addr, in makeSortableAddress()
57 return new DnsUtils.SortableAddress(stringToAddress(addr), in makeSortableAddress()
63 final List<DnsUtils.SortableAddress> test = Arrays.asList( in testRfc6724Comparator()
109 DnsUtils.SortableAddress test = makeSortableAddress("216.58.200.36"); in testV4SortableAddress()
134 DnsUtils.SortableAddress test = makeSortableAddress("2404:6800:4008:801::2004"); in testV6SortableAddress()